I find it a bit bizarre that this JEP doesn't enable Compact Object Headers by default. Most users will not know to specifically enable it, so if they're that confident in its stability and performance, why not enable it for everyone?

The JVM used to have a reputation for requiring byzantine flags to properly optimise its performance (mostly GC configuration). We've mostly left that behind these days, but it feels like JEP 519 takes a step backwards here.

  • jeroenhd 7 months ago

    The JVM world is slow and extremely careful. If there's a chance something that once works breaks, it'll take many years before the change is applied by default.

    Many JVM users can make huge performance gains by switching the GC to a better once and by toggling all kinds of options.

  • pron 7 months ago

    These things tend to be done gradually out of an abundance of caution. Assuming the experience remains positive, it will be made the default in some future release.
